Using the right tools

Agents can work with vague instructions just fine — Oxygen converts the HTML and CSS they write into native, fully editable elements. But the more specific you are, the better the outcome will be, so naming the capabilities you want and turning on the right tools will get you closer to the result you pictured.

Ask for Oxygen’s capabilities

Call them out in your brief or prompt:

  • Interactions & animations — hovers, scroll effects, transitions.
  • Dynamic data — loops, custom fields (ACF, Meta Box), and templates.
  • Components — reusable blocks you edit in one place.
  • Variables & classes — for consistent, global styling.
  • Responsive — ask it to check tablet and mobile.

Enable the right skills and abilities before you start

Oxygen works with any coding agent that supports MCP connections, which means it can also work with your existing skills and workflows. A good example of this is Claude Code’s Frontend Design Skill. If you have it installed with your agent, it’ll use it when building sites with Oxygen.

Another great tool is the Universal Abilities from Agent Connector for WP, which lets your agent manage media, run WP-CLI, install plugins, and call other plugins’ abilities too.
